Prep and cook Time
- Preparation: 15 minutes
- Cooking: 40 minutes
- Total Time: 55 minutes
Yield
Serves 6 generous portions
Difficulty Level
Easy to Medium – perfect for both novice and seasoned home cooks
Ingredients That Elevate the Flavor and Keep It Gluten-Free
- 2 tbsp olive oil – brings a subtle fruity richness and helps sauté aromatics
- 1 large yellow onion, finely diced – adds a sweet and savory foundation
- 3 cloves garlic, minced – imparts deep, aromatic warmth
- 1 poblano pepper, seeded and diced – offers mild heat with a smoky undertone
- 1 jalapeño pepper, minced (optional) – customize your preferred spice level
- 1 tsp ground cumin – introduces earthy, warm spice
- 1 tsp smoked paprika – adds vibrant smoky flavor
- 1/2 tsp dried oregano – enhances depth and complexity
- 1 (14.5 oz) can diced tomatoes – lends acidity and brightness
- 4 cups gluten-free chicken broth – the heart of your soup, rich and savory
- 2 cups cooked, shredded chicken breast – tender protein boost
- 1 cup frozen corn kernels – for sweetness and texture
- 1 lime, juiced – freshens and balances flavors dramatically
- Salt and black pepper – essential seasonings to taste
- 6-8 gluten-free corn tortillas – sliced thinly and toasted to crispy perfection
- Fresh cilantro leaves, chopped – for garnish and herbal brightness
- 1 avocado, diced (optional) – creamy, cooling contrast
- Shredded sharp cheddar or Monterey Jack cheese (optional) – melty richness to finish
Step-by-Step Preparation for a Rich and Comforting Soup
-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add diced onion and sauté until translucent, about 5 minutes, stirring occasionally to avoid browning.
- Add minced garlic, diced poblano, and jalapeño (if using).Cook another 3 minutes until fragrant and softened.
- Sprinkle in ground cumin, smoked paprika, and oregano, stirring frequently to toast the spices gently and unleash their flavors, about 1 minute.
- Pour in the diced tomatoes with their juices and stir well to combine. Allow the mixture to simmer for 5 minutes,breaking up tomatoes with the back of your spoon.
- Pour in the gluten-free chicken broth and bring the soup to a rolling simmer.
- Add the shredded chicken and frozen corn. Reduce heat to low and cook, uncovered, for 15-20 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ld beautifully.
- Season with salt, black pepper, and fresh lime juice, adjusting to taste. The lime juice really brightens the deep, smoky base.
- While the soup simmers, prepare your tortilla strips: slice the gluten-free corn tortillas into thin strips. Toast or lightly fry them in a skillet until golden and crisp,then set aside on paper towels.
- Serve the soup garnished with crispy tortilla strips,chopped cilantro,diced avocado,and cheese if desired. Each element adds a distinct texture and flavor, creating a warming, layered experience.
Tips for Customizing Heat and Texture to Your Taste
- Prefer less heat? Omit the jalapeño or remove seeds from the poblano pepper for milder spice.
- For more crunch, add extra toasted tortilla strips just before serving.
- To make the soup heartier, toss in canned black beans or diced sweet potatoes during simmering.
- Want a silky finish? Blend half the soup before adding chicken for a thicker base.
- If dairy-free, omit cheese and avocado or replace with a dollop of coconut yogurt for creaminess.

Q: Is this soup suitable for meal prepping or freezing?
A: Yes! This soup holds up well in the fridge for several days and freezes beautifully. To retain the best texture, it’s recommended to add the tortilla strips fresh when serving rather than before freezing, ensuring that delightful crunch remains intact.

Q: can I use store-bought rotisserie chicken to save time?
A: Definitely! Using pre-cooked rotisserie chicken is a great shortcut. Simply shred the meat and stir it into the soup near the end of cooking. This saves prep time while still delivering that hearty, homemade taste.
